Hi all,

I was recently uploading and decided to test what difference exclusive images makes to revenue, search results and acceptance or reviews.

Out of the big 6, which if the sites actually support exclusive images.
I'm not talking about being an exclusive contributor - simply the images.

So far, I can only see that Dreamstime and Fotolia support this?
Any others?

Is there any benefit to the contributor to submitting exclusive images?

I have some exclusive images on DT and the sale increase is not bad.  Is it worth it, kind of hard to say.  Those images might bring in more money on the other sites, but the reason they are exclusive is they are models.  I just personally hate uploading all the model forms, so DT gets all my model exclusive rights.

I have a few exclusive images on Fotolia and don't remember any one of them ever selling at all.

OTOH I have uploaded exclusive images to Dreamstime's monthly contests and they do sell.  In fact I just sold two of them today and the royalties were over $5 each.
